Spicew has just launched Stellar Series of Smartphones. They are not available as yet but will be available soon. Out of the 3 models Spice Stellar loooks good and suits your requirement.
The Spice Stellar (priced at Rs. 9,999) sports a 4-inch display of 800×480 pixel resolution and it is powered by a 1GHz Qualcomm Snapdragon processor and 245MHz GPU. The device runs Android 2.3 Gingerbread, however Spice has mentioned that it will be upgradable to Android 4.0 ICS. The device also includes a 5 megapixel rear camera with autofocus and flash, it has a front facing VGA camera, 512MB of RAM and up to 32GB of expandable storage via microSD card. It comes with a decent 2000 mAh battery which is rated for up to 7 hours talktime and up to 120 hours of standby.
Also Stellar Horizon (priced at Rs. 11,999) comes with Android 4.0 Ice Cream Sandwich and sports a 5-inch display. This is a dual-SIM capable smartphone which is powered by a 1GHz dual-core Qualcomm Snapdragon processor, supported with a 300MHz GPU. It has a 5 megapixel rear camera with autofocus and flash and a secondary front facing VGA quality camera. It is also expected to have huge battery life, but the battery size has not been mentioned in the press release.
So, if you can wait for few days then you can have a lok at them when they launch.

bro samsung star duos (GT-B7722) is not a smart phone. it has got Proprietary OS (SHP OS) i.e. you wont be able to install new apps from the android market and app availablity will be close to nil..
Few more -ves :
multitasking is unavailable .. hangs too much inspite of 270MB internal mem.. and internet surfing is very poor even on 3G. (phone hangs too much )
+ves :
5 MP, 2560х1920 pixels, autofocus, LED flash …. card slod of MicroSD up to 16GB …Document viewer (word , excel, pdf) but only viewer – no editing option…
i would not suggest for this phone.. seeing its price which is in the range of 8500-10000… you can get a lot more feature rich phones in this price range..

hello, it would be better if you could specify the budget and feature requrements also… anyways you can choose anyone from below list..
Samsung Galaxy Ace Duos: Running Android 2.3 OS, this dual SIM phone has a 3.5-inch touchscreen and a 3.15 megapixel camera. The phone costs approx. Rs 13,500.
Micromax A50: It runs Android 2.3.6 Gingerbread OS. Priced at Rs 4,999, it is a dual SIM phone, which has a 3.1-inch capacitive touch screen and a 2 megapixel camera. It features an app AISHA that translates words into action.
Samsung Galaxy Y Duos: Available at approximately RS 9,000, this dual SIM phone runs Android 2.3 OS. It has a 3.14-inch touchscreen and a 3 megapixel camera.
Samsung Galaxy Y Pro Duos: It features a capacitive touchscreen with a QWERTY keypad. It has a 3 megapixel camera. The phone is available in the market for around Rs 9,500.
Karbonn A7: It has a 5 megapixel primary camera, and runs Android 2.3 OS. This dual SIM phone has a 3.5-inch touchscreen. It costs around Rs 7,500.
